Course details

Here are the essential units for a Global Certificate Course in Waste Transport Logistics: • Waste Management Fundamentals: This unit covers the basics of waste management, including the importance of proper waste disposal, the different types of waste, and the role of waste transport logistics in the waste management process. • International Waste Transport Regulations: This unit explores the various international regulations and standards that govern waste transport, including the Basel Convention, the Rotterdam Convention, and the Stockholm Convention. • Waste Classification and Segregation: This unit delves into the importance of proper waste classification and segregation, including the different methods and techniques used to categorize and separate waste, and the role of waste transport logistics in this process. • Sustainable Waste Transport: This unit focuses on the sustainable aspects of waste transport, including the use of alternative fuels, the reduction of carbon emissions, and the implementation of environmentally friendly practices in the waste transport industry. • Global Waste Transport Logistics: This unit examines the global waste transport logistics industry, including the different types of waste transport, the role of logistics in waste management, and the challenges and opportunities facing the industry. • Waste Handling and Storage: This unit covers the proper handling and storage of waste, including the use of appropriate containers, the need for secure storage facilities, and the importance of proper waste disposal. • Environmental Impact Assessment: This unit explores the environmental impact of waste transport, including the effects of waste transport on air and water quality, and the role of environmental impact assessments in the waste transport industry. • Waste Reduction and Minimization: This unit focuses on the importance of reducing and minimizing waste, including the use of recycling and composting, and the role of waste transport logistics in this process. • Global Waste Management Strategies: This unit examines the global strategies for waste management, including the role of government, industry, and individuals in reducing waste and promoting sustainability. • Case Studies in Waste Transport Logistics: This unit presents real-life case studies of successful waste transport logistics operations, including the challenges and opportunities faced by these companies, and the strategies they have implemented to achieve success.

Waste Transport Logistics Career Roles:
Waste Transport Manager Oversees the transportation of waste, ensuring efficient and cost-effective operations.
Logistics Coordinator Coordinates the movement of goods and materials, including waste, to ensure timely delivery.
Waste Management Specialist Develops and implements strategies for managing waste, including transportation and disposal.
Transportation Planner Plans and coordinates the movement of goods and materials, including waste, to ensure efficient use of resources.
Operations Manager Oversees the day-to-day operations of a waste transport logistics company, ensuring smooth and efficient operations.
